If `I_(1)` and `I_(2)` be the size of the images respectively for the two positions of lens in the displacement method, then the size of the object is given by

A

`I_(1)I_(2)`

B

`sqrt((I_(1)I_(2)))`

C

`sqrt((I_(1)//I_(2))`

D

`sqrt((I_(1)//I_(2)))`

Text Solution

Verified by Experts

The correct Answer is:
B
